As far as the eye could see, there were bookshelves, stretching endlessly. Although it seemed that the Hall of Letters was not small from the outside, it was certainly not this vast. However, now was not the time to ponder such matters; what Wang Long and the others were most interested in was how to bring all these books back! 0
 
Of course, if that proved impossible, they would need to deepen their relationship with the True Navigator and ensure they could frequently obtain information from the divine realm. 0
 
"These few volumes here are summaries of tactics against the Yin Ghost Clan compiled by our elders and disciples during the War of Gods and Demons. They include actual battle cases. However, after our research, we found that the only strategies involve small-scale movements or sending elite experts for reconnaissance. The Army should bring more experts in breaking formations and avoid charging directly into the traps set by the Yin Ghost Clan. We couldn't discern anything beyond that." 0
 
Wang Long chuckled inwardly: "Of course you can't see much. But these insights will be quite different in our hands." 0
 
"These few books contain information about the experts of the Yin Ghost Clan whose identities have been revealed over time, compiled based on accounts from those who have fought them. It is estimated that we have gathered information on all currently living experts of the Yin Ghost Clan." 0
 
Cai Burin, with his usual demeanor of believing himself to be the best in the world, retorted, "Is that so? Then I wonder if you have any information on that famous disciple named Dizang who killed an elder-level expert from Dragon City in a single strike?" 0
 
"Hmph! There is indeed no such person; at least, I don't recall anyone by that name," Wuxuan Daoist sneered. "Perhaps it's just because your so-called elders in Dragon City are too weak? Even a random stray cat or dog could take them down." 0
 
"You!" 0
 
"Wuxuan, don't say that," True Navigator interjected with a frown, sensing the tension in their words. "Regardless, that Elder of Dragon City died opposing the Yin Ghosts. Do you also look down on those heroic souls who were killed by the Yin Ghost Clan?" 0
 
Wuxuan's expression changed as he realized he had been too harsh with the young girl and had said something inappropriate. However, given his status, he couldn't bring himself to apologize directly to her. 0
 
For the first time, Wang Long felt anger towards Wuxuan. No matter what, he absolutely did not want his fallen subordinates to be mentioned in such a tone! 0
 
Tian Xuan Dao Ren noticed Wang Long and the others' displeasure and quickly interjected, "Wang Long, may I ask you something?" 0
 
 
Wang Long slightly calmed down. Regardless of the other party's status, it was inappropriate for him to directly counter their lowered stance. However, he did not want to say much and simply nodded silently. 0
 
"Among the experts we have collected from the Yin Ghosts, there is indeed no one named Dizang. So I wanted to ask how he made his move; perhaps we can find some clues from the Yin Ghost experts we already know. I believe that besides wanting to understand this formidable enemy, Wang Long is also very eager to avenge his subordinates, right?" 0
 
What Tian Xuan Dao Ren said was reasonable, which greatly increased Wang Long's goodwill: "To be honest, at that time we were dealing with multiple strong enemies, so I personally did not witness the scene. I could only hear my disciples recounting it later. According to them, that member of the Yin Ghost Clan effortlessly killed our elder in one strike, without any resistance. The method was extremely cruel; he directly extracted all of our elder's spiritual veins from his body, causing him to die in excruciating pain." 0
 
"Is that so..." Although everyone present had experienced many battles, they were still shocked by the gruesome scene described by Wang Long. "Alas, how pitiful." 0
 
"Elder True Navigator and Elder Wuxuan Tianxuan, according to what you said, has there never been anyone with such a cruel method in all these years of struggle against the Yin Ghost Clan?" 0
 
Elder True Navigator nodded gravely: "Absolutely not from any family. I once thought that Dizang might be a hidden expert they had kept away or a newly emerged young master. But from what you just said, it seems he is completely different from any expert of the Yin Ghost Clan, and his cruel methods are quite rare even among them!" 0
 
Wang Long exchanged glances with the others; this result was beyond their expectations. 0
 
The three from Xuanmen were not much better off either. In True Navigator's mind, an image involuntarily surfaced of someone being held captive and having their spiritual veins painfully extracted from their flesh, causing a wave of horror within. 0
 
"This time I truly apologize; I didn't expect to be unable to help you at such a critical moment," True Navigator said sadly. 0
 
"There’s no need for you to say that, we have already gained a lot," Wang Long replied as he watched Wuxuan and Tianxuan using special spiritual techniques to create copies of the contents from the books, seemingly splitting one book into two. It appeared that Wang Long's earlier description of the elder's tragic death had affected their state of mind; this time even Wuxuan did not say much more. 0
 
"Obtaining so much useful information will greatly benefit our battle against the Yin Ghost Clan. Please rest assured, Elder True Navigator; without your permission, we will only circulate this intelligence within the upper echelons of Dragon City and will absolutely not let it spread outside." 0
 
"Hmph, that's more like it." At this point, Elder Wuxuan and his companion had completed their cultivation. With a wave of their sleeves, they gathered the separated books together. "Alright, keep these items; they are written in great detail inside. Remember your own strength; sometimes understanding your enemy is not enough to secure victory." 0
 
 
Wang Long and the others couldn't help but have a significant change in their perception of Wuxuan. 0
 
Although the previous statement seemed to carry an implication of striking them, it also revealed a kind reminder, which was completely different from the previous relentless suppression they had experienced. 0
 
"Thank you, Elder Wuxuan, for your reminder. We will absolutely not engage in battles we are not confident about." 0
 
"Who reminded you?" Elder Wuxuan snorted coldly, his demeanor returning to its icy state. "I was merely thinking that if you could lure out that cruel Dizang again, it would be best to kill him. Even if we can't kill him directly, at least we can gather more information about him for research." 0
 
"Uh..." That really was quite ruthless. 0
